Idea

Chinese and overseas suppliers lie about production capacity, leaving importers stuck. Build a verification platform where suppliers upload capacity docs and past order history, with verification badges and third-party audits. Target: e-commerce and product importers.

Why this is interesting

Supply chain due diligence has become a genuine pain point since COVID-era disruptions exposed how badly importers misunderstood their suppliers' real throughput, and the ongoing shift toward nearshoring and supplier diversification means more buyers are vetting new relationships than ever before. No clear incumbent owns this specific niche — Alibaba's Trade Assurance and platforms like Sourcify touch adjacent problems but don't systematically verify capacity claims with document trails and audit badges. The $2k–10k/mo revenue band is plausible only if you can charge suppliers for verification badges (they have incentive to pay) while keeping audit costs low, but the margin gets thin fast if third-party audits require human boots on the ground in Guangdong or Shenzhen. The core failure risk is trust circularity: importers won't pay for badges unless they trust the verification process, suppliers won't submit to rigorous audits unless importers demand it, and bootstrapping both sides of that marketplace with one cross-source mention of demand signal is a slow, expensive chicken-and-egg problem.
